December 6, 1921 — The Irish Free State Is Born
After years of revolution and rising tensions, the Anglo-Irish Treaty is signed in London, bringing an end to the Irish War of Independence and establishing the Irish Free State as a self-governing dominion of the British Commonwealth.
📌 Why This Matters
The signing of the treaty split Ireland, not just territorially, but ideologically. While it was seen as a major step toward sovereignty, many Irish republicans, including Éamon de Valera, rejected the compromise, setting the stage for the Irish Civil War. The legacy of this pivotal agreement still echoes in the geopolitics of Ireland and Northern Ireland today.

Michael Collins, one of the treaty’s signatories, famously said:
"In signing this Treaty I have signed my death warrant."
Less than a year later, he was assassinated during the civil conflict that erupted in its wake.
